What Ingredients Are Needed for the Perfect Guacamole Seasoning?

The secret to the best guacamole seasoning recipe is finding that balance between fresh ingredients and spices. Here are the key ingredients you’ll want to have on hand for a basic seasoning and your additions if you’d like to make your guacamole memorable.

Essential Ingredients:

  1. Salt: A small pinch of salt enhances the natural flavor of the avocados.
  2. Pepper: Black or white pepper adds a subtle heat.
  3. Garlic Powder: A classic addition, giving guacamole a savory depth.
  4. Onion Powder: Adds sweetness and richness to the flavor profile.
  5. Lime Juice: Fresh lime juice adds acidity and balances the richness of the avocado.

Optional Ingredients:

  1. Cumin: A teaspoon of cumin can add a smoky, earthy flavor that elevates the dish.
  2. Chili Powder: A bit of chili powder can provide some heat and an extra layer of flavor.
  3. Paprika: This adds a touch of sweetness and color to your guacamole.
  4. Fresh Cilantro: Adds a fresh, herbaceous note to your guacamole.

How to Make the Best Guacamole Seasoning Recipe

Making your own guacamole seasoning recipe is easy and customizable. Here’s a simple step-by-step guide:

Store for Future Use: If you’ve made a big batch, you can store the extra guacamole spice mix in an airtight container for future use.

Start with Basic Seasoning: Combine one teaspoon of salt, 1/2 teaspoon of garlic powder, 1/2 teaspoon of onion powder, and a squeeze of fresh lime juice. This basic blend works well for most people, but feel free to adjust it to your liking.

Add Optional Ingredients: To enhance the flavor, add 1/4 teaspoon of cumin and chili powder for a smoky kick, or a pinch of paprika for sweetness. Adjust the quantity based on how much guacamole you plan to make.

Taste and Adjust: The key to a great guacamole seasoning recipe is tasting as you go. If you like more spice, add extra chili powder. If you prefer a tangier flavor, squeeze in more lime juice.

How to Use Guacamole Seasoning in Your Recipe

Now that you have your guacamole seasoning recipe, it’s time to put it to use!

Steps for Using Your GGuacamole Seasoning Recipe:

  1. Prepare the Avocados: Peel and mash 2-3 ripe avocados in a large bowl.
  2. Add the Seasoning: Sprinkle the seasoning mix over the mashed avocados. Start with about one tablespoon of seasoning per 2 avocados, then adjust based on your taste.
  3. Mix Well: Stir the seasoning into the avocado mixture until it’s evenly distributed.
  4. Taste and Adjust: Give it a taste and add more seasoning if needed.

The beauty of guacamole seasoning recipes is their flexibility; you can always add a little more of your favorite spices or fresh ingredients like chopped cilantro or diced tomatoes.

How Long Does Guacamole Last After Seasoning?

Guacamole with seasoning lasts about 1-2 days when st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ator. To prevent browning, cover the guacamole with plastic wrap that touches the surface of the guacamole.

Guacamole Seasoning Recipe

This guacamole seasoning recipe is a simple yet flavorful blend that will take your guacamole from good to great. Using a mix of classic ingredients like salt, pepper, garlic powder, and lime juice, along with optional spices like cumin and chili powder, you can easily customize this seasoning to suit your taste. Whether you prefer a mild or spicy guacamole, this recipe provides the perfect balance of flavors to enhance the creamy avocado base.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Total Time 10 minutes
Course Appetizer
Cuisine Mexican
Servings 4
Calories 150 kcal

Equipment

  • Small mixing bowl
  • Measuring spoons
  • Fork or masher (for mashing the avocado)
  • Airtight container (for storing extra seasoning, optional)

Ingredients
  

  • Essential Seasoning Ingredients:
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on onion powder
  • 1 tablespoon fresh lime juice
  • 1/4 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
  • Optional Ingredients for Extra Flavor:
  • 1/4 teaspoon cumin for smokiness
  • 1/4 teaspoon chili powder for heat
  • 1/4 teaspoon paprika for color and sweetness
  • 2 tablespoons fresh cilantro for a fresh, herbal touch

Instructions
 

  • Prepare the Avocados: Start by peeling and pitting 2-3 ripe avocados. Mash them in a bowl using a fork or a potato masher until you achieve your desired texture (smooth or slightly chunky).
  • Make the Guacamole Seasoning: In a small mixing bowl, combine the salt, garlic powder, onion powder, and pepper. Add lime juice and mix until the ingredients are well-combined.
  • Customize the Flavor: If you're using the optional ingredients, add cumin, chili powder, paprika, and cilantro to the seasoning mix. Stir everything together to create a balanced, flavorful seasoning blend.
  • Season the Guacamole: Sprinkle the seasoning mix over the mashed avocado. Stir well to ensure the seasoning is evenly distributed throughout.
  • Taste and Adjust: Taste the guacamole and adjust the seasoning to your liking. If you prefer more spice, add extra chili powder or cumin. If it needs more acidity, squeeze in more lime juice.
  • Serve and Enjoy: Serve your guacamole immediately with tortilla chips, tacos, or your favorite dishes.

Notes

  • Make-Ahead: You can prepare the seasoning mix in advance and store it in an airtight container for future use. This helps save time when making guacamole on short notice.
  • Adjusting the Spice Level: If you like a milder guacamole, reduce the amount of chili powder and cumin. For extra heat, add finely chopped fresh jalapeños or a pinch of cayenne pepper.
  • Freshness Matters: For the best guacamole, always use ripe avocados. They should yield to gentle pressure but not be too soft.
  • Storage Tips: If you have leftovers, store guacamole in an airtight container. To prevent browning, cover the guacamole with plastic wrap that directly touches the surface before sealing.
